In the gpu comparison between the ASUS Dual Radeon RX 6600 and the G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1080 Ti Gaming OC BLACK 11G, we compare both the technical data and the benchmark results of the two graphics cards.

GPU

The ASUS Dual Radeon RX 6600 is based on the AMD Radeon RX 6600 and has 1792 texture shaders and 28 execution units.

G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1080 Ti Gaming OC BLACK 11G is based on N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1080 Ti, which has 3584 shaders and 28 execution units.

Memory

The ASUS Dual Radeon RX 6600 has 8 GB of graphics memory of the type GDDR6 and achieves a memory bandwidth of 224 GB/s.

The G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1080 Ti Gaming OC BLACK 11G can access 11 GB GDDR5X graphics memory and thus achieves a memory bandwidth of 484 GB/s.

Clock Speeds

The ASUS Dual Radeon RX 6600 clocks in the base with up to 1.626 GHz. The base frequency of the G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1080 Ti Gaming OC BLACK 11G is 1.518 GHz.

Thermal Design

The TDP (Thermal Design Power) of the ASUS Dual Radeon RX 6600 is 132 W. The graphics card is supplied with energy via the 1 x 8-Pin connector.

The G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1080 Ti Gaming OC BLACK 11G has a TDP of 280 W and is supplied with the required energy via 1 x 6-Pin, 1 x 8-Pin PCIe power connectors.

Additional data

The ASUS Dual Radeon RX 6600 was released in Q4/2021 at a price of 329 $ (Reference).

The G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1080 Ti Gaming OC BLACK 11G was introduced in Q1/2017 at a price of 699 $ (Reference).
